Local man recovering from double organ transplant, assistance sought for medical bills

Michael Merritt was diagnosed with end-stage liver disease and renal failure. He has been to many doctor appointments and endured several hospitalizations during the past six months.

Michael’s health began deteriorating rapidly over the last month. On Tuesday, August 25,  Michael had bloodwork in Tifton, and he had a follow-up appointment on August 27, where the doctor sent him immediately to Emory due to the results and the build-up of fluid in his body. 

Once arriving at Emory, Michael had various tests performed and learned that afternoon that he had been added to the list as a candidate for a double liver and kidney transplant.

With his health deteriorating so rapidly, he was moved to the top of the list. In the meantime, Michael received a port for dialysis and was moved into ICU, where dialysis was started.  

On August 28, Michael and his family were notified that matching donor organs were available for his transplant. The doctors continued the dialysis and prepared Michael’s body for the transplant surgery during the time the donor organs were being tested for compatibility. 

On August 29, around 5 p.m., the transplant team began Michael’s operation, which continued until 4:30 a.m. the next morning. The doctors reported successful results from the double transplant. 

Michael and his family are now in need of financial support with medical bills, travel expenses, and the expensive immunosuppressant medicines that help prevent rejection of the newly transplanted organs. 

The road to recovery will be long.  Michael will have to remain in Atlanta for at least a month.
